Information About 1492-SPM1C100
The 1492-SPM1C100 is a supplementary protector (miniature circuit breaker) from Allen-Bradley’s 1492-SPM series, designed to provide reliable overcurrent protection for control circuits and electrical equipment in industrial and commercial applications.
Key Features:
- Type: Supplementary Protector / Miniature Circuit Breaker (MCB)
 - Supported Applications: Control circuits, industrial equipment, commercial electrical panels
 - Functionality: Provides overcurrent protection to prevent damage from short circuits and overloads
 - Poles: 1-pole
 - Current Rating: 100 A
 - Trip Curve: C-curve (suitable for general-purpose loads with moderate inrush currents)
 - Breaking Capacity: Typically 10 kA (varies by regional standards and certification)
 - Voltage Rating: Up to 480Y/277V AC (check specific certifications for exact ratings)
 - Mounting: DIN rail mountable for easy installation
 - Standards Compliance: UL 1077, CSA, CE, and IEC 60947-2 standards
 - Environmental Rating: Designed for industrial environments; specific ingress protection depends on enclosure used
 
The 1492-SPM1C100 is a dependable solution for protecting sensitive equipment and control circuits, offering easy installation, reliable performance, and compliance with international safety standards.
